Blue Jays finalize roster for Opening Day

The Blue Jays have their 25-man roster ready for Opening Day.

The Toronto Blue Jays have finalized their Opening Day roster.

The Blue Jays were informed of the team’s final roster decisions Wednesday morning and the moves are expected to become official later this afternoon.

Alex Anthopoulous confirmed the team will start the season with an eight-man bullpen, eliminating one of the tougher final decisions for the Blue Jays, as both Brett Cecil and hard-throwing Jeremy Jeffress will open the year with the big club.

 

Both Cecil and Jeffress were out of options coming into the 2013 season and were said to be in a position battle for the final spot in the bullpen.

Cecil can now serve as the long man and will add a left-handed arm coming out of the pen.

There were no surprises with the team’s makeup on offence as the Blue Jays will start the season with all their projected regulars except for third baseman Brett Lawrie, who will open the year on the 15-day disabled list with a strained rib.

 

With Lawrie down, Mark DeRosa and Maicer Izturis will fill the void at third base – meaning Emilio Bonifacio could see the majority of time at second base.

Bonifacio has struggled a bit with his throwing accuracy at second base during the spring but provides a welcome speed element to the Blue Jays lineup.

After catcher Josh Thole was sent down earlier this week, Henry Blanco won the job as the back-up catcher. But as Shi Davidi wrote earlier in the week, Blanco and J.P. Arencibia will both catch for knuckleballer R.A. Dickey – who was originally expected to have his own personal catcher.

Arencibia will start behind the plate on Opening Day against the Cleveland Indians.
